Description
Are you are family with an older relative who you would like to live with you? Or do you have the need to move your family that includes a young couple? These are just two examples where this property, which comes with a full functioning and compliant 1 bedroom annex could fulfil those needs. Although currently set up as a 2 separate dwellings, scope remains to reconfigure to create a multitude of options, owing to the sheer square footage, utility supplies, and significant plot.
Situated at the top of Kitchener Road, the end terrace position affords the property further land to the side providing parking for multiple cars. The wide access driveway means you can swing your cars into park easy peasy, and beyond the driveway there is an integrated garage / workshop with power.
On entering through the porch into the hallway, a right turn takes you through the dining room with parquet flooring, and into the lounge, which history tells us was once a shop floor in days of old, adding further character to this period home. A well equipped kitchen and bathroom complete the downstairs layout connected to the traditional house. Upstairs is where things get really interesting. Another right turn at the top of the stairs leads you to two large double bedrooms, well decorated and one with double aspect providing plenty of light. A left turn at the top of stairs through the large landing, leads to a whole further apartment, with it's own kitchen, lounge, and bedroom, totally self contained.
Viewing the 3d tour of this property is strongly advised to gain an understanding of the layout, and unleash your mind with the possibilities of what this property could do for you.
Outside there is a well maintained garden with decking, and shed in equally good order.
